nixos/parsedmarc: Improve secret handlingorigin/backport-177783-to-release-22.05
Make secret replacement more robust and futureproof:
- Allow any attribute in `services.parsedmarc.settings` to be a
secret if set to `{ _secret = "/path/to/secret"; }`.
- Hash secret file paths before using them as a placeholders in the
config file to minimize the risk of conflicting file paths being
replaced instead.
